Description from the seller

Manufacture : Meissen (Germany).
Model: Footed coupe / compote with a festooned edge.
Decoration: Hand-painted naturalistic flower bouquets (style "Deutsche Blumen") and floral sprigs. Gilded rims and fine gold fillets.
Period: 19th century, the so-called "Knauf" period (Knaufzeit).
Condition: Exceptional condition, showroom piece never used. Brilliant gilding, no chipping, no cracks, no restorations.
Marks and Signatures (see photos):
Base: Blue underglaze Meissen crossed swords with finials (Knauf mark).
Quality: First quality (no grind marks on the swords).
Model number: Incised mark "H 130".
Modeler number: Incised mark "26".
Painter number: The figure "27" painted in blue.
The compote is removable (comes apart in two parts: bowl and foot), which facilitates thorough cleaning and guarantees secure shipment in two separate pieces.
